PTI challenge the references against MPA


LAHORE:

Pakistan Tehreek-E-Insaf (PTI) plans to launch a national protest movement for the launch of its imprisoned founder Imran Khan.

When heading to a press conference on Tuesday, the opposition leader at the Punjab Assembly, Malik Ahmad Khan Bhachaha, said an announcement about the movement would be held later this week.

In response to media consultations, Bhachaha accused the government of using multiple failed tactics to dismantle party leadership.

He announced that PTI would challenge the references presented by the president of the Punjab Assembly, Malik Muhammad Ahmad Khan, against 26 opposition legislators.

He accused the decision of the Muslim League of Pakistan-Nawaz (PML-N) to orchestrate the suspension of the members to appease Prime Minister Maryam Nawaz.

“We 107 MPA keep us firm. We will not bow to Maryam Nawaz,” he said. “On Thursday, we will convene a parallel session of our ‘real’ assembly outside the Punjab Assembly.
